• Backlit Onyx Installations: This trend involves illuminating onyx slabs from behind to showcase their natural translucence and intricate veining. It is used to create stunning feature walls, countertops, and bar fronts. The impact is a dramatic and luxurious aesthetic that transforms a space into a work of art, making it a powerful statement piece in high-end residential and commercial projects.
• Rise of Engineered Onyx: Engineered onyx is a composite material made from onyx fragments and resin. This trend offers a more consistent, durable, and cost-effective alternative to natural onyx. The impact is a wider market accessibility, allowing onyx to be used in more high-traffic areas without the traditional concerns of fragility and maintenance.
• Use of Bold and Exotic Colors: Designers are moving beyond traditional white and beige onyx to embrace bold hues like blue, green, and multi-color varieties. This trend is driven by a desire for unique and personalized spaces. The impact is a more vibrant and expressive design palette, giving architects and designers greater creative freedom to create truly one-of-a-kind interiors.
• Biophilic Design Integration: This trend involves incorporating natural materials to connect occupants with nature. The natural patterns, colors, and textures of onyx align perfectly with biophilic principles. The impact is an increase in the material's use for creating serene and wellness-focused environments, such as luxury spas, lobbies, and residential bathrooms.
• Sustainable Sourcing Practices: There is a growing demand for responsibly sourced and ethically mined onyx. This trend is influenced by rising environmental awareness among consumers and designers. The impact is a shift towards a more transparent supply chain and a focus on minimizing the environmental footprint of quarrying and production, enhancing the brand image and value of the stone. • Development of Reinforced Slabs: Recent developments include the use of mesh or honeycomb backing to reinforce fragile onyx slabs. This technology strengthens the stone and makes it less prone to breakage during transportation and installation. The impact is a more durable and reliable product, reducing waste and allowing for the use of thinner slabs in larger applications.
• Innovations in LED Backlighting Technology: Advancements in LED lighting have revolutionized how onyx is used. New, low-heat LED panels and fiber optics allow for consistent and vibrant illumination without damaging the stone. The impact is the creation of stunning, luminous features that are energy-efficient and visually striking, solidifying backlit onyx as a premier design element.
• Advanced Stone Processing and Cutting: The use of advanced CNC machinery and waterjet cutting technology has become more widespread. These precision tools allow for intricate and custom designs, minimizing material waste. The impact is increased efficiency and the ability to produce complex patterns and shapes that were previously impossible, opening up new design possibilities.
• Emergence of New Quarry Sources: The discovery and development of new onyx quarries in various regions are helping to diversify the market and increase the availability of different colors and patterns. This addresses the supply chain challenges associated with the rarity of some onyx varieties. The impact is a broader selection of unique stones and increased market competition.
• Growth in E-commerce and Digital Marketing: Online platforms and virtual design tools are making it easier for consumers and designers to visualize and purchase onyx. High-quality digital catalogs and augmented reality tools allow for a better understanding of the stone’s appearance. The impact is an expanded market reach and a streamlined purchasing process for a global clientele. • Luxury Residential Interiors: Onyx is a prime choice for high-end residential applications such as kitchen countertops, backsplashes, and vanity tops. The opportunity lies in offering custom, book-matched installations. The impact is significant market growth in the affluent residential sector, where homeowners are willing to invest in unique, statement pieces that enhance their home's value and aesthetics.
• Hospitality Sector: Hotels and high-end restaurants are a major growth area, using onyx for reception desks, bar counters, and wall cladding. The opportunity is in creating immersive, memorable environments. The impact is the establishment of onyx as a signature material in luxury hospitality design, where its backlit properties create a captivating and exclusive ambiance for guests.
• Retail and Commercial Spaces: High-end retail stores and corporate lobbies are increasingly using onyx to create a luxurious brand image. The opportunity is to design bespoke, high-impact installations that align with a company's identity. The impact is a new revenue stream and a way for brands to differentiate themselves through unique and visually stunning interior architecture.
• Architectural Feature Panels: Onyx can be used as a decorative, lightweight facade or as a feature panel in a building's interior. The opportunity lies in developing new, lightweight composite panels for architectural use. The impact is the ability to use onyx in new, large-scale applications, such as building exteriors or large interior feature walls, which were previously impractical due to weight and fragility.
• Custom Furniture and Sculptures: Onyx is increasingly being used in custom-made furniture pieces like dining tables, coffee tables, and artistic sculptures. The opportunity is to collaborate with high-end furniture designers and artists. The impact is a premium niche market with high-profit margins, showcasing the stone's versatility beyond traditional architectural applications and elevating it as a material of choice for bespoke creations. • United States: The U.S. market is witnessing strong growth fueled by luxury real estate. Designers are increasingly using onyx for high-impact features like backlit walls, bar counters, and decorative installations. Technological advancements in cutting and polishing are enhancing design possibilities, making the stone more versatile for custom, high-end projects.
• China: China is a significant player, with its market driven by a booming luxury real estate sector and increasing consumer wealth. The country has become a major exporter of processed onyx slabs. There's a notable trend toward using bold, colorful onyx varieties in both residential and public-facing commercial spaces, such as hotel lobbies and retail stores.
• Germany: Germany's market, as part of Europe's, is seeing a rise in sustainable sourcing. The focus is on ensuring that onyx is quarried and processed with minimal environmental impact. The market is driven by a demand for premium, high-quality materials for upscale residential and boutique commercial projects, where its aesthetic appeal is a key selling point.
• India: India's onyx market is evolving rapidly, with a growing domestic demand for luxury interiors. Key developments include a strong export market, with Indian onyx gaining popularity in the U.S. and Europe. There's also a significant trend towards using bold colors and unique patterns, with backlit onyx installations gaining immense traction in high-end projects.
• Japan: Japan's onyx market is characterized by a strong appreciation for minimalist but striking design. Recent projects showcase the stone’s use in creating immersive, art-like environments, particularly in retail and hospitality sectors. Developments focus on using onyx in a sophisticated manner to create serene and luxurious spaces.
